What is the cost of a psychiatric consultation?
Psychiatrists are able to diagnose Msa mental health assessment disorders and prescribe medications. They can also provide psychotherapy. However, the cost of a psychiatric consult will vary. The cost can be affected by the location, duration of the sessions and even the years of experience of the psychiatrist. Generally speaking, psychiatric clinics located in urban areas are more expensive than those in rural areas. Psychiatrists who specialize in specific conditions may also charge more than others.
Patients will be required to pay for any necessary tests and bloodwork or other specialized treatments. This could add up to an impressive amount of money. The average psychiatric consult without insurance will cost you around $100 per hour. The initial consultation is typically more expensive, as the psychiatrist must take longer to complete a thorough psychiatric assessment. Then, follow-up appointments can be less expensive because the sessions are generally geared towards treatment.
There are ways to cut down on the cost if you don't have insurance. First, you can inquire with your insurance provider to determine which psychiatrists are in-network. This means that they've agreed to an affordable rate with the insurance company. You can also ask your psychiatrist whether they provide an affordable sliding scale of fees that are based on your income.
Another way to save the cost of psychiatric appointments is to explore an online psychiatric consultation. This is a growing trend that offers many benefits over traditional in-person visits. For example you can talk to a psychiatrist from anywhere in the world via video calls that are secure. A lot of these services can be accessed through a monthly subscription. They are a great option for those without insurance or who wish to avoid the hassles of finding a psychiatrist within their area.

What is the cost of a psychiatric treatment?
The cost of psychiatric treatments can vary widely based on several factors. For instance, the amount of time spent with the psychiatrist can affect the total cost. The kind of treatment provided and the amount of time spent affect costs. Many people with a mental health condition require regular sessions with a therapist to control their symptoms. The cost of these treatments can mount up quickly. There are ways to reduce the cost of psychiatric treatment.
Find out if your insurance covers psychiatric consultations. The initial visit could be covered by your insurance or come at a reduced price. Once the psychiatrist has diagnosed you, they can create an appropriate treatment plan. This treatment plan can include medication and/or therapy. The psychiatrist will determine the price of the medication and therapy.
The more experience a psychiatric has, visit the next internet site the higher the cost. Some psychiatrists specialize in certain disorders, which can increase the cost of their services. Some psychiatrists require a down payment before scheduling an appointment. The deposit will be refunded when the appointment is complete.
Another way to lower the cost of treatment for psychiatric disorders is to choose generic medications. Generic drugs are usually between 80 and 85% less expensive than brand-name drugs. They can also help you save on prescription costs, which can be a significant expense.
There are psychiatrists that offer sliding scale fees. This is a fantastic option for those who are not able to pay for full-price services. This option is available in most community mental health clinics as well as certain private practices.
The people who don't have access to a private psychiatric can seek help through public programs. These programs are often subsidised by local governments or the state. However, they could have lengthy waiting lists. Additionally they aren't as flexible as private alternatives. Some people may be unable to meet the requirements of these programs. For example they may be required to attend group therapies.
